prim_asm.h revision f78b12e570284aa8291f4ca1add24937fd107403
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va/****************************************************************************
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* Realmode X86 Emulator Library
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* Copyright (C) 1996-1999 SciTech Software, Inc.
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* Copyright (C) David Mosberger-Tang
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* Copyright (C) 1999 Egbert Eich
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* ========================================================================
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* Permission to use, copy, modify, distribute, and sell this software and
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* its documentation for any purpose is hereby granted without fee,
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* provided that the above copyright notice appear in all copies and that
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* both that copyright notice and this permission notice appear in
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* supporting documentation, and that the name of the authors not be used
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* in advertising or publicity pertaining to distribution of the software
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* without specific, written prior permission. The authors makes no
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* representations about the suitability of this software for any purpose.
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* It is provided "as is" without express or implied warranty.
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* THE AUTHORS DISCLAIMS ALL WARRANTIES WITH REGARD TO THIS SOFTWARE,
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S, IN NO
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* EVENT SHALL THE AUTHORS BE LIABLE FOR ANY SPECIAL, INDIRECT OR
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M LOSS OF
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T, NEGLIGENCE OR
cf1a1e4ff7ce44c49851316f405815c0eeffb132Eugenia Sergueeva* O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ION WITH THE USE OR
692a3ba4c94e1b157797c47cb7bd8cb1c5f6004eJoe Bandenburg* PERFORMANCE OF THIS SOFTWARE.
#ifndef __X86EMU_PRIM_ASM_H
#define __X86EMU_PRIM_ASM_H
#ifdef __WATCOMC__
#ifndef VALIDATE
#define __HAVE_INLINE_ASSEMBLER__